The North American and Pelican Nebulae in Ha

100 Ha subs of 30s, gain of 440 and sensor temperature of -30°C.  Processed with BPP in PixInsight then histogram stretched and slightly cropped in Photoshop.  135mm Super Takumar lens, ZWO EFW and ASI1600MM-Cool camera on EQ8 mount unguided.

Thank you Knight and Olly - yes I'm quite pleased with this one :)  But no still at full aperture of f 2.5.  Apart from not needing guiding, another benefit is that when there are clouds but clear patches of sky you can catch some good images between clouds.
